    I've been taking singing lessons and I would love to sing like Arab singers 🥺 do their techniques have a name? How am I supposed to learn??

    • @thearabicmusicland
      @thearabicmusicland  2 года назад +5

      I've never had any vocal lessons, but I know that the arabic scale is different than the western one, thus some runs sound off key to a western ear, but they actually are accurate in the arabic scale. the best way to learn Arabic singing is listening to great arab singers and try to imitate them, Try Asmahan, Umm Kulthum, Sabah Fakhri, Majida EL Roumi, Fairuz ....and more.
